Erding: Ibrahimovic in class of three

Mevlut Erding says Zlatan Ibrahimovic is one of the ‘three best players’ in the world, alongside Lionel Messi and Cristiano Ronaldo.

The Swede grabbed all the headlines in the off-season after leaving AC Milan to join wealthy Paris Saint-Germain in a blockbuster 20 million-euro deal, and has made a stunning start to life at the Parc des Princes with five goals in his first four games.

Erding, who played for PSG between 2009 and 2012, was part of the exodus following the club’s Qatari takeover last year, but he nonetheless proceeded to shower praise of the highest order on his fellow striker.

“He is one of the three best players in the world, alongside Messi and Ronaldo,” the Turkey international told France Football.

“We are lucky to have him in Ligue 1. What impresses me is his poise and confidence, he is 200 percent assured, and this is the main strength he has in addition to others.”
